Transaction 254f5938aaf28f63f1962297e195e3842c1470871741dd88f309756385f4de59
1 Input
1 Output
-
254f5938aaf28f63f1962297e195e3842c1470871741dd88f309756385f4de59:0
- value
- 13467984
- script pubkey
- OP_0 OP_PUSHBYTES_20 b39aca586f58e332d42bc0551b096a8885385a3f
- address
- bc1qkwdv5kr0tr3n94ptcp23kzt23zznsk3lkngtyj